Leon Thomas Jr. was born on May 5, 1965 on Selfridge Air National Guard Base, Harrison Township, Michigan to the parentage of Marjorie Gantt Thomas and Leon Thomas, Sr. whom both preceded him in death.
Leon Thomas, Jr. attended Mt. Clemens High School in Michigan. Then after Indiana College of Architecture before enlisting into the United States Army as a E4 Chef on December 28, 1984 until December 16, 1987. Leon Jr., was employed by General Dynamics, and United States Post Office in Oakland, California for 10 years.
Leon's dream was to become a Church of Christ Minister and attended S.W. School of Bible Study in Austin, Texas.
Leon Jr., loved to sing and write music.
Leon was stationed in Monterey, California where he met and married Katy James and out of their union came, Keshena (Sacramento) and Laquan Thomas (Florida).
Leon Jr., is survived by two siblings, Lafanita (Madagette) Elzy and Diane L. Thomas of Arlington, Texas; one grandchild, Brandon Oscilia; nieces and nephews, Cortez, Deon, Simon, and Simona, along with a host of other relatives and friends that loved him dearly.
